A vaccine was only widely approved in 2019, and while two intravenous antibody treatments improve outcomes, they require costly cold storage.
The team infected rhesus and cynomolgus macaques with a high dose of the Makona variant of the Ebola virus. A day after exposure, ten monkeys then received an Obeldesivir pill daily for ten days ...
